What Is a 100kW Solar System?

A 100kW solar system is a commercial-scale photovoltaic installation, several times larger than the residential systems most homeowners install. Where a typical home might run on 3kW to 10kW, a 100kW plant is built for organizations running machinery, HVAC, cold rooms, office equipment, water pumps, and other energy-hungry infrastructure through the day.

Because most commercial and industrial electricity use happens during daylight hours, solar generation lines up naturally with demand. That makes a 100kW system one of the more financially efficient ways for a business to offset a large, high-tariff electricity bill — and where net metering applies, any surplus can be exported to the grid for further credit.

Space is usually the first practical question we’re asked. A 100kW array needs roughly 6,000 to 7,000 square feet of usable roof or ground area, though the exact figure shifts with panel wattage, walkway allowances, and structural layout. For roof-mounted arrays, we run a structural assessment before finalizing the design; for ground-mounted projects, civil foundations and site leveling are factored into the plan from day one. Many businesses find that sheds, warehouse roofs, factory rooftops, and unused agricultural land are a natural fit for a plant this size.

What Determines the Price?

Because a 100kW project is a large investment, the final price is always confirmed after a site survey — but these are the main factors that move the number up or down.

Panel wattage & brand
Higher-wattage panels (550W–615W) reduce the panel count needed and can improve space efficiency.
Inverter configuration
On-grid, hybrid, or battery-ready designs (e.g. 2×50kW or 3×33kW units) carry different costs.
Roof vs. ground mount
Ground-mounted arrays need civil foundations; roof-mounted arrays need structural assessment.
Cabling & protection
Cable runs, combiner boxes, breakers, surge protection, and earthing scale with plant size.
Net metering requirements
DISCO documentation, bidirectional meters, and approvals add to project scope where needed.
Site location & access
Transport, crane access, and site complexity all factor into the final commercial quote.

What’s Included in a 100kW System

Every 100kW installation from Pakistan Solar Traders is built from the same core components, sized and configured for your specific site.

☀️ Tier-1 Solar Panels

Around 180–250 high-efficiency panels from brands like Jinko, LONGi, Canadian Solar, Trina, or JA Solar.

🔌 Commercial Inverters

String inverters such as 2×50kW or 3×33kW configurations convert DC power to usable AC electricity. See our inverter range.

🏗️ Mounting Structure

Industrial-grade galvanized steel or aluminum, engineered for wind load, roof condition, and array layout.

🛡️ Protection & Cabling

DC/AC cables, isolators, breakers, surge protection, combiner boxes, and earthing built to safety standards.

📡 Monitoring System

Cloud-based dashboards give you real-time generation, performance, and alarm data on desktop or mobile.

The Financial Outlook of a 100kW Solar Plant

A project of this size is best evaluated the way you’d evaluate any long-term business asset — not just on the upfront cost, but on annual savings, payback period, equipment lifespan, and how much electricity tariffs are likely to rise over the next decade. For organizations already paying high commercial rates, the savings from a 100kW plant compound year after year, often well beyond the panels’ 25-year performance warranty.

The actual payback period varies with your self-consumption ratio, export credits under net metering, daily production, total project cost, and how well the system is maintained. What stays consistent across almost every commercial installation we’ve delivered is the shift from an unpredictable monthly expense to a controlled, largely fixed energy cost — which makes budgeting and financial planning considerably easier for management.

How much roof or ground space does a 100kW system need?

Typically 6,000 to 7,000 square feet, though this varies with panel wattage and layout. Higher-wattage panels reduce the module count and can improve space efficiency.

How many units does a 100kW system generate?

Under good sunlight conditions, expect roughly 400–550 units per day, 12,000–16,500 per month, and 144,000–198,000 per year, depending on location, orientation, weather, and maintenance.

Is net metering available for a 100kW system?

Yes, where DISCO approval applies. A bidirectional meter allows surplus units exported to the grid to offset imported units, improving overall project economics. We assist with the documentation and approval process.

Can a 100kW system be expanded later?

In many cases, yes — if additional roof or ground space and sanctioned load are available. We design with future expansion in mind wherever possible.
